  • Patent number: 11664820
    Abstract: An apparatus, method and computer program is described comprising: initialising weights of a target encoder based on a source encoder; initialising weights of a target discriminator associated with the target encoder such that the target discriminator is initialised to match a source discriminator associated with the source encoder; applying some of a target data set to the target encoder to generate target encoder outputs; applying the target encoder outputs to the target discriminator to generate a first local loss function output; training the target encoder to seek to increase the first local loss function output; training the target discriminator to seek to decrease the first local loss function output; and synchronising weights of the target discriminator and the source discriminator.
    Type: Grant
    Filed: June 3, 2020
    Date of Patent: May 30, 2023
    Assignee: Nokia Technologies Oy
    Inventors: Shaoduo Gan, Akhil Mathur, Anton Isopoussu
  • Patent number: 11620497
    Abstract: An apparatus that operates in a first mode of operation to enable performance of a first predetermined task to transfer data via a transmitter device to a receiver device across a first communication channel using a first artificial neural network, wherein the first artificial neural network is partitioned to the transmitter device and the receiver device, and operate in a second mode of operation to enable performance of a second predetermined task to transfer data via the transmitter device to the receiver device across a second communication channel using a second artificial neural network, wherein the second artificial neural network is partitioned to the transmitter device and the receiver device, and determine to operate the apparatus in the first mode or the second mode.
    Type: Grant
    Filed: May 20, 2019
    Date of Patent: April 4, 2023
    Assignee: Nokia Technologies Oy
    Inventor: Anton Isopoussu
  • Patent number: 11403510
    Abstract: An apparatus comprising means for: using a generative neural network, trained to translate first sensor data to simulated second sensor data, to translate input first sensor data from a first sensor to simulated second sensor data; and providing the simulated second sensor data to a different, specific-task, machine-learning model for processing at least second sensor data.
    Type: Grant
    Filed: July 16, 2019
    Date of Patent: August 2, 2022
    Assignee: NOKIA TECHNOLOGIES OY
    Inventors: Akhil Mathur, Anton Isopoussu, Nicholas Lane, Fahim Kawsar
